We are currently seeking an administrator to join our Warehousing team on a permanent basis. The Warehousing team is responsible for handling pulp and timber cargo and container packing operations.
About the Role:
The Warehouse/Terminal Administrator, reporting into the Operations Supervisor - Warehousing, provides coordination and administrative support to the Warehouse and Terminal Services team to ensure efficient and effective service delivery for our customers. This role plays a key part in supporting our Warehouse team by managing accounts, maintaining strong customer relationships, and providing administrative assistance to the Operations Supervisor.
